This is a HOT album with a selection of great songs that can cater to a variety of musical tastes, of all ages I might add. I have to admit I got the album based on the song "One Day in Your Life," but I found that I LOVED the whole CD and am now playing it all the time, much to the annoyance of my upstairs neighbour! Anastacia ROCKS is all I can say. She sure knows how to belt out a song and she does it with such passion and gusto you find yourself shouting out the song with her...very embarrasing when you're on the bus heading home from work I can tell you!A nice CD with great tracks such as "Secrets" and "How Come the World Won't Stop." As a pointer try and get a glimspe of the music video that goes with the song "One Day in Your Life", it is wonderfully funny, and sexy and you will love the tatoos that are on display on a variety of people, including a mother, a handsome young man who's pumping iron and Anastacia herself. The song stands on its own but the video is worth a peek.

...Anastacia successfully combines Pop, Funk, Dance and R&B into one rather slim and drop dead gorgeous package. The opening title track acts as Anastacia's mantra "look at me and see a little girl inside my skin / It's supernatural / I'm a freak of Nature" and "just cause I like sipping on champagne / doesn't mean that I'm afraid of the rain." Anastacia stakes her claim as the one to resist the cookie cutter mold. Gotta love the 'tude. Stellar numbers with rather cliche titles shine. "OverDue Goodbye" and "How Come the World Won't Stop" capture the girl with the greek name's vulnerable side. The shining tune "Why'd You Lie to Me" treads Deborah and Whitney territory, but with a fresh slant. Anastacia's been there with a boy and is bitter,.. The single slated for U.S. release, "One Day in Your Life," picks up where "I'm Outta Love" left off... Destined for club success, this high energy R&B thumper is hot, but the real struggle is whether Anastacia's intense vocal prowess can translate to radio airplay. In an environment dominated by Ja Rule collaborations and Timbaland remixes, can Anastacia find her niche in the pop market? Given the standard of her last album,' Not That Kind', you could be forgiven for thinking that Anastacia had reached her peak vocally. However, when you listen to this new album you'll soon realise Anastacia has reached an entirely new level. 'Freak of Nature' is best described as a roller coaster of an album, ranging from soulful ballads right through to funk influenced numbers. This album improves on the last, as there are fewer of the weaker ballads present on the last album, and with the exception of the slightly boring 'I dreamed you' the album is a modern classic.
